Hello,

I am a newbie to PIC so excuse me for my ignorance. I am trying few things
with PIC16F877a and using JDM programmer along IC-prog. I was able to
successfully program PIC16F877a several times till few hours ago. I was
trying an LED flashing program on port-A (got from web, written for 16F84a)
, with my PIC device and having trouble since LEDs connected to RA0 was
flickering senselessly. On my board I had PIC's VDD, VSS connected to supply
and XTAL acroos OSC lines. Since this was my very first rig-up of PIC,
suspecting to have missed out some connection, coupled with a vague memory
of reading in web about 877a requiring logic on RB3/PGM line I pulled it
high (not sure what state MCLR was at this point). From this point onwards I
am no longer able to program the device. I get verification error.

Did I spoil the device by doing so? I am confident of JDM setup, since I am
able to program a 16F84.

Any help in this regard is highly appreaciated.

PS: Just learnt that RA0 is default analog pin. Guess this was the reason
for my LEDflash program failure.

You gotta put RB3 LOW, not HI, to keep that program mode out of play.
